绝对值和小数向上、向下取整、四舍五入
2017-02-07 13:14
549 查看
abs, fabs, fabsf分别对应整形,float ,double
例如fabs(-0.856) = 0.856;
ios小数向上、下取整,计算结果向上、下取整:
小数向上取整,指小数部分直接进1 x=3.14,ceilf(x)=4
小数向下取整,指直接去掉小数部分 x=3.14,floor(x)=3
小数处理 四舍五入
NSLog(@”%f”,round(12345.6789));//12346.000000
NSLog(@”%f”,round(12345.6749*100)/100);//12345.670000
NSLog(@”%@”,[NSString stringWithFormat:@”%.2f”,round([num floatValue]*100)/100]);//12.13
例如fabs(-0.856) = 0.856;
ios小数向上、下取整,计算结果向上、下取整:
小数向上取整,指小数部分直接进1 x=3.14,ceilf(x)=4
小数向下取整,指直接去掉小数部分 x=3.14,floor(x)=3
小数处理 四舍五入
NSLog(@”%f”,round(12345.6789));//12346.000000
NSLog(@”%f”,round(12345.6749*100)/100);//12345.670000
NSNumber *num = [NSNumber numberWithFloat:12.1250];
NSLog(@”%@”,[NSString stringWithFormat:@”%.2f”,round([num floatValue]*100)/100]);//12.13
相关文章推荐
- 对小数取整(向上取整,向下取整,四舍五入,舍弃小数)
- PHP取整,四舍五入取整、向上取整、向下取整、小数截取
- PHP取整,四舍五入取整、向上取整、向下取整、小数截取。
- PHP取整,四舍五入取整、向上取整、向下取整、小数截取
- PHP取整,四舍五入取整、向上取整、向下取整、小数截取
- PHP取整四舍五入取整、向上取整、向下取整、小数截取
- PHP取整,四舍五入取整、向上取整、向下取整、小数截取
- js 小数取整,js 小数向上取整,js小数向下取整
- js中小数向上取整数,向下取整数,四舍五入取整数的实现(必看篇)
- python(50):python 向上取整 ceil 向下取整 floor 四舍五入 round
- R里数字常规除法,整除,求余,取整,向上取整,向下取整,四舍五入
- PHP数学运算: 向上/向下取整及四舍五入
- iOS 中常用的几种函数 (向上,向下,四舍五入)取整, 总算是理解了
- Sql Server 向上取整,向下取整,四舍五入
- python中四舍五入及向上向下取整处理
- php,js小数取整数函数,丢弃小数部分,向上取整数,四舍五入,向下取整数 ...
- js只保留整数,向上取整,四舍五入,向下取整等函数
- 向上/向下取整和四舍五入编程实现
- js只保留整数,向上取整,四舍五入,向下取整等函数
- python 向上取整ceil 向下取整floor 四舍五入round